Transaction 27956dc6b908f8079e8bc1392108d7af3220e23363060ac3e6cfa44e4dda51a3
1 Input
1 Output
-
27956dc6b908f8079e8bc1392108d7af3220e23363060ac3e6cfa44e4dda51a3:0
- value
- 121596
- script pubkey
- OP_0 OP_PUSHBYTES_20 83b9cc10983e748fd8d0a5aea2d7103b31f23ae4
- address
- bc1qswuucyyc8e6glkxs5kh294cs8vclywhyf6agtq